The decision you're actually making

You're not choosing between agencies. You're choosing against a job req.

Hire an SDR
~$27,000

Per quarter, fully loaded - salary, tools, and the management time to run them. Six to ten weeks to fill the role, another two to three months to ramp. Your first meeting arrives somewhere in month four.

Work with us
Live in ten days

First outreach within ten business days of signature - it's in the agreement. Conversations in week two, meetings from week three. Materially less than the hire, and you can stop at the end of any quarter without a severance conversation.

How it works

Three steps, and the first one is the one that matters.

  1. We define your ICP together - precisely enough to be a contract term

    Not "mid-market fintech." A written specification: company criteria, person criteria, disqualifiers, and the edge cases nobody normally argues about until month two. You sign it. It becomes the definition of what we get paid for.

    This session does as much for you as it does for us. Most teams arrive certain of who they're after and leave with something considerably sharper - and once it's written down, we're both aiming at the same thing.

  2. We work it one prospect at a time

    We read what that specific person has said and done, then write to them about it. No merge fields, no list blast, nothing goes out that we wouldn't sign our own name to. It's slower per prospect, and that is the entire reason it works.

  3. Qualified meetings land on your calendar

    With a brief on each one twenty-four hours ahead - who they are, what they said, what they'll likely ask. Plus a same-day heads-up on anything that can't wait, and a monthly report you can forward without editing.

Why this is different

Three things, and you should hold us to all of them.

You see every message we send

Verbatim, in the report - along with the replies we got, including the ones that don't flatter us. Ask anyone else you're talking to whether they'll show you their copy. The answer tells you what they're doing.

Your ICP is a contract term, not a briefing document

If someone outside it asks for a meeting, we don't book it and we don't bill you for it - we tell you about it and you can overrule us. That's an unusual amount of discipline to accept, and it's why our meeting counts are lower and better than what you'll be quoted elsewhere.

It also means changing it isn't free. A meaningful change to the specification means rebuilding the target list, the research and the messaging from the ground up, so it's charged at 75% of the original build fee. Small refinements as we learn are part of the work and cost nothing.

We tell you what isn't working, in writing

Segments we killed and why. Messages we retired. Commitments we missed. A vendor who only ever reports good news is a vendor you will fire in month four.
